WebJul 21, 2024 · Although leg and thigh meat is safe at 165°F you should cook your chicken until you reach an internal temperature of 170-175°F (77-79°C). Chicken legs are muscle and sinew (much like all legs) and contain meat that is a bit tougher than the rest of the bird. WebOct 3, 2024 · All poultry: Cook poultry (ground or whole) to an internal temperature of 165 F as measured with a food thermometer. To obtain an accurate reading, the food thermometer should be placed in the thickest part of the food, away from bone, fat or gristle. Too many temperatures to remember?
